摘要

基于藜麦全基因组和转录组数据,利用生物信息学的方法对藜麦CqOSC基因家族进行了鉴定和系统分析.结果表明,在藜麦基因组中鉴定到15个CqOSC基因家族成员,可分为3个亚组,同亚组CqOSC基因具有相似的基因结构和蛋白Motif结构;在藜麦正常生长发育过程中,CqOSC基因家族成员的表达模式存在明显差异,CqOSC7和CqOSC12在花和未成熟的种子及干种子中显著表达,而CqOSC9与CqOSC10在所有组织中均呈现出一定水平的表达;对于MeJA具有不同响应:CqOSC2、CqOSC4和CqOSC8基因表达量变化显著;CqOSC3、CqOSC6和CqOSC15基因表达量变化不明显;整体表现为"低促高抑":在外施0.5 mmol/L和1 mmol/L MeJA时基因表达量显著上升,在浓度达到2 mmol/L时表达量显著下降.

Abstract

Based on quinoa genome-wide and transcriptome data,the CqOSC gene family of quinoa is identified and systematically analyzed by bioinformatics.The results show that 15 members of the CqOSCgene family are identified in the quinoa genome,which could be divided into three subgroups,and the same subgroup CqOSC genes have similar gene structure and protein motif structure.During the normal growth and development of quinoa,CqOSC7 and CqOSC12 are significantly expressed in flowers and immature seeds and dried seeds,while CqOSC9 and CqOSC 10 show a certain level of expression in all tissues.There are different responses to MeJA:the expression of CqOSC2,CqOSC4 and CqOSC8 genes change significantly,in contrast to case of CqOSC3,CqOSC6 and CqOSC15.The overall performance is"low promotion and high inhibition":whereas gene expression increases significantly when 0.5 mmol/L and 1 mmol/L MeJA are applied externally,it decreases significantly when the concentration reaches 2 mmol/L.
